Adds validation to webhook URLs before attempting to deliver them to prevent SSRF attacks targeting private IP ranges, local host, and cloud metadata endpoints. Validates URL schema, hostname, and applies `is_private_ip()`. Also resolved ruff linting errors. Tests have been expanded to ensure validation covers all cases.
